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K Current Report was filed by QuidelOrtho Corporation on November 19, 2024, with the earliest event reported on that date. The filing primarily addresses a secondary underwritten offering of common stock by a selling stockholder affiliated with The Carlyle Group and the subsequent resignation of two directors.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ing does not provide standard financial performance metrics such as revenue, profit, cash flow, margins, debt, or liquidity. The only financial data disclosed relates to the specific transaction:
- Shares Sold: 8,260,183 shares of common stock.
- Offering Price: $35.314 per share.
- Company Proceeds: $0. The Company did not sell any shares and received no proceeds from this transaction.
Material Changes
The filing reports two material changes effective November 21, 2024:
- Board Composition: James R. Prutow and Robert R. Schmidt resigned from the Board of Directors. These resignations were submitted in accordance with the Principal Stockholders Agreement and were not the result of any dispute with the Company.
- Shareholder Structure: The sale of shares by the Selling Stockholder resulted in the termination of the Principal Stockholders Agreement dated December 22, 2021.
Outlook, Risks, and Unusual Items
Transaction Details: The offering was underwritten by Goldman Sachs & Co. LLC. The Company and the Selling Stockholder agreed to indemnify the underwriter against certain liabilities under the Securities Act of 1933.
Risks and Contingencies: The filing notes that the resignations were not due to disagreements regarding operations, policies, or practices. No other risks or contingencies were disclosed in this specific report.
